So many romance books appear to be obsessed with eyes.  Every major character in romance books has some kind of extraordinary eye color, whether it’s vivacious aquamarine, smoky whiskey, cool ice gray, startling emerald, or unreadable obsidian. I was always aware that certain writers had favorite words and phrases they used throughout their books; that doesn’t bother me.  But I’ve been having a speed-read marathon of popular romance selections, both past and present, and there seems to be a collective “romance voice” with romance lingo.
